A full time (10 PA) post as a Locum Specialist in Neurology and Stroke Medicine is available at Buckinghamshire Healthcare NHS Trust for a 6-month fixed-term locum with possible extension depending on performance and progress. The post will be based at Wycombe Hospital in High Wycombe, although there will be service commitments in Neurology at Amersham hospital and Stoke Mandeville Hospital.

It is expected if the candidate continues that at the end of 18 - 24 months the candidate will be able to apply for Portfolio Pathway(CESR) to obtain CCT in Neurology. The trust has recently appointed and supported 2 Locum Specialist Doctors one of whom has completed the application process for CESR, awaiting outcome.



A higher degree/SCE in Neurology is desirable but not essential, providing a candidate has sufficient experience in General Neurology, Acute Neurology, Hyperacute stroke (thrombolysis & acute interpretation of CTA) and TIA. Candidates with good clinical experience will be considered and if successful will be supported for Portfolio Pathway to obtain CCT in Neurology.



This is part replacement post due to the retirement of one of the current consultants, and part new post. The successful candidate will be one in eight consultants/specialists contributing to the stroke on-call rota (SPOC). There are currently seven Neurologists and three stroke physicians in the trust.
